We compared two Desktop platform GPUs: 4GB VRAM Moore Threads MTT S1000M and 8GB VRAM RTX A1000 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
Moore Threads MTT S1000M 's Advantages
Larger VRAM bandwidth (224.0GB/s vs 192.0GB/s)
Lower TDP (35W vs 50W)
NVIDIA RTX A1000 's Advantages
Released 1 years and 9 months late
Boost Clock1462MHz
More VRAM (8GB vs 4GB)
1280 additional rendering cores
